Why Pre-Season AC Preparation Matters in North Texas Heat

In Plano, your AC isn’t a luxury; it’s critical home infrastructure. Our combination of long cooling seasons, high humidity swings, and intense sun exposure makes pre-season preparation more important here than in milder climates.

The strain of a Plano summer

By June, many systems are running 10–14 hours a day. That kind of runtime amplifies any underlying issues:

  • A slightly dirty coil can become a major efficiency loss.
  • A small refrigerant leak can turn into frozen coils and no cooling.
  • A weak capacitor can become a no‑cool emergency on the hottest weekend.

“Most major summer failures start as minor issues in spring.” — Efficient Home Solutions Technician

We routinely see Plano homeowners who skipped routine AC maintenance service end up needing air conditioning repair in July, when parts may take longer and schedules are packed.

A real-world example

A family in the Preston Meadow area called us last August: the home was 82°F inside, the system running nonstop. Their AC was only eight years old—nowhere near end of life—but the outdoor coil was caked in dirt and the attic insulation had settled to well below recommended levels. The system wasn’t broken; it was overwhelmed.

A professional cleaning, refrigerant charge correction, and upgraded attic insulation brought their runtime down dramatically and dropped summer bills by more than 20%. All of that could have been addressed proactively in spring, before the discomfort and stress.

Step One: A Professional AC Tune-Up vs. Waiting for a Breakdown

The first and most important step in preparing your air conditioning for summer is a professional tune-up. There’s a big difference between a quick visual check and a true performance-focused service.

What a quality AC service includes

A thorough spring air conditioning service should cover:

  • Checking refrigerant levels and superheat/subcooling (not just “topping off”)
  • Testing electrical components like capacitors and contactors
  • Cleaning or washing condenser coils
  • Inspecting blower motors and belts
  • Checking thermostat operation and calibration
  • Measuring temperature differential across the coil
  • Inspecting drain lines and pans for clogs and leaks

We follow ACCA (Air Conditioning Contractors of America) maintenance standards, which are widely recognized in the HVAC industry.

Tip: Ask your technician for before/after readings of temperature split and amperage draw. It’s an easy way to see the impact of your tune-up.

Beyond the Unit: Attic Insulation and Ventilation’s Role in Cooling

Even the best AC can’t perform well if your home’s envelope is working against it. In Plano’s climate, attic conditions are one of the biggest factors in how hard your system has to work.

Why your attic matters for summer comfort

On a 100°F day, attics in North Texas often reach 130–150°F. Without proper home insulation and attic ventilation, that heat radiates down into your living space and ductwork, forcing your AC to run longer to maintain the same temperature.

We often find:

  • Fiberglass batts that have slumped or been displaced
  • Old blown-in insulation that no longer meets recommended R-values
  • Little to no ridge or soffit ventilation
  • Ducts running through superheated attic air

Protecting the Weakest Link: Attic Access and Air Leakage

One of the most overlooked parts of summer preparation is also one of the simplest: sealing and insulating the access point to your attic.

Why the attic hatch or stair matters

Pull-down attic stairs and access panels are often huge sources of air leakage and heat gain. In many Plano homes, that opening sits right in a hallway or above a main living area.

Without protection:

  • Hot attic air seeps down into your home
  • Conditioned air rises and escapes into the attic
  • The area beneath the hatch is always warmer
Tip: If you feel a noticeable temperature difference standing under your attic stairs, you’re likely losing energy there.

A small upgrade with big returns

We often recommend an attic access tent or insulated cover—sometimes called an attic stair cover or insulated attic access cover. These products:

  • Create an air seal around the opening
  • Add insulation value where there often is none
  • Are easy to open and close when you need to access the attic

When It’s Time to Talk Replacement, Not Just Repair

Sometimes, preparing for summer means facing the reality that your current system is at the end of its useful life. In Plano, where systems run hard for many months, that point often arrives between 12–15 years for many units, depending on maintenance and installation quality.

Signs you may need a new system

You don’t need to guess. Common indicators include:

  • Frequent air conditioning repair calls over the last few summers
  • Rising energy bills despite regular tune-ups
  • Hot and cold spots that won’t resolve
  • Loud operation, short cycling, or poor humidity control
  • Equipment age over 12–15 years, especially if poorly maintained

Frequently Asked Questions

Q: When should I schedule AC service before summer in Plano?
A: In our climate, the ideal time for AC maintenance service is early spring—typically March through early May. That window gives you time to address any issues before the first major heat wave and before the busiest part of the season for technicians. If you wait until it’s already in the high 90s, you may face longer wait times and limited appointment options. Even if you’ve missed the “early” window, it’s still worth scheduling a tune-up as soon as possible; the system will run hard through late summer and often into early fall in Plano.


Q: How do I know if I need AC repair or a full replacement?
A: Age, repair history, and performance are the main clues. If your system is under 10 years old, most problems can be addressed with AC repair, unless there’s a major failure like a compressor. Once systems pass 12–15 years, especially with frequent breakdowns or rising energy bills, it’s time to weigh HVAC replacement. A thorough inspection—sometimes paired with a home energy audit—can reveal whether duct issues, poor insulation, or ventilation problems are stressing your system. Q: Does attic insulation really make a noticeable difference in summer cooling?
A: Yes, especially in North Texas. Under-insulated attics are one of the most common reasons we see for systems struggling to keep up. Upgrading attic insulation reduces heat gain into your living space and ductwork, which means your AC doesn’t have to run as long to maintain setpoint. Plano homeowners often report better comfort in upstairs rooms and fewer hot spots after improving insulation and attic ventilation. An insulation contractor can assess whether you need additional blown-in insulation, air sealing, or other upgrades to reach recommended R-values for our area.


Q: What is a home energy audit, and how does it help my AC perform better?
A: A residential energy audit is a detailed assessment of how your home uses and loses energy. For Plano homeowners, that often includes checking insulation levels, duct leakage, air sealing, and equipment performance. By identifying where your home is wasting energy—such as leaky ducts in a hot attic or an unsealed attic access—we can recommend targeted improvements that reduce AC runtime and improve comfort. An HVAC energy audit can also reveal whether your system is properly sized and installed, which is critical for efficient cooling in our climate.

Q: What can I do myself to get my AC ready for summer, and what should a professional handle?
A: As a homeowner, you can:

  • Replace or clean filters regularly
  • Clear debris and vegetation from around the outdoor unit
  • Gently rinse the outdoor coil with a garden hose (no high pressure)
  • Check and clear visible drain line outlets

These steps help, but they don’t replace a professional air conditioning service. A licensed technician should handle refrigerant checks, electrical testing, internal coil cleaning, and any AC repair. They have the tools and training to catch hidden issues safely and ensure your system is operating within manufacturer specifications—critical when facing Plano’s extreme heat.


Q: How does my furnace or heating system factor into summer AC performance?
A: In many Plano homes, the furnace and AC share the same blower, ductwork, and indoor coil. Issues with the blower motor, dirty furnace compartments, or duct problems can impact cooling performance too. That’s why we often look at both sides of your system, offering heating repair and furnace maintenance along with AC service. A clean, properly functioning blower and duct system helps move cool air efficiently throughout your home. If you’ve had winter heating issues, it’s wise to address them before summer, so your shared components are ready for heavy cooling season use.
